Re: [plugin] [ORPHAN] mdp_calendar

quemultimedia wrote:

How does one apply CSS styles to the calendar?

Since I’ve pretty much rewritten this entire plugin I feel qualified to answer: it’s limited. You have 4 classes available:

  1. the entire table (if you used the plugin’s class attribute)
  2. if a cell contains an event it is tagged with class hasarticle
  3. if the cell is today’s date it is tagged with class today
  4. if the cell is empty (i.e. the blank cells at the start/end of the month) the cell has a class of invalidDay

That’s it. The rest you’ll have to do with CSS selectors. If that’s not enough and you want complete control over the cells and classes, wait a tiny while for smd_calendar to be officially released, which gives you the freedom to build a calendar and manage events exactly how you want to.
